Top Considerations For Construction Cost Data Estimation

By James White


Most project planners and owners usually think that overrun in projects that go unnoticed until estimators do their work cause the financial losses. They may be right but there are so many other factors that come in to play. Accurate estimations of the budget help the stakeholders to run the project successfully. However, when the price control is neglected, there will be huge problems in the budget. To be on the safer side, there is a need to use advanced ways to perform construction cost data evaluation. Some of the critical areas of the estimation include the following.

Without having proper materials in the site, the project will surely not run. Therefore, materials are critical to make the project a success. For large projects, there is a better chance of reducing the price because the materials will be ordered or bought in volumes. However, the hiccup comes during the shipping or transportation. The material rates are thus estimated using the standard information book.

With sufficient labor, the project will surely become a success. However, when there are problems in labor, the entire project wills also be affected. The standard cost book is thus used by the estimators to draft a labor forecast that is accurate. Knowing the total price of labor helps the project owners and contractors avoid unforeseen expenses.

Additionally, equipment is also necessary to run projects. Most of the equipment costs usually seem fixed. Nevertheless, the planners and estimators try so hard to reduce the expenses. They therefore use either alternative or rental equipment. This is critical as it reduces the expenses drastically. Other final expenses that are usually indirect like insurance or licensing are also estimated and the total budget becomes adjusted.
